As a curvy girl, one fashion trend I always avoid is the babydoll dress. They generally just don’t look very good on my figure because they lack shape. Since I have wide hips. babydoll dresses tend to look like a big tent on me. I need dresses that define my waistline, which is why I usually opt for a-line or wrap dresses.

Every year in January, I realize I don’t really own the right types of coats to live in LA. The weather in LA is normally so mild, that I rarely need anything more than a sweater or maybe a denim jacket. But in December through February, it can become deceptively cold-feeling, even if it’s in the 60s.

A black pleather dress offers style and versatility, making it a fantastic addition to any wardrobe. Pleather, a synthetic alternative to real leather, mimics its look and feel without using animal products. It’s cheaper and easier to care for. I recently found the perfect black pleather dress.
